Bathroom Faucet Repair in Denver, CO

Bathroom faucet repair services address issues related to malfunctioning or leaking faucets in residential bathrooms. This includes fixing leaks, replacing faulty cartridges or washers, restoring proper water flow, and resolving problems with handles or spouts. Projects often involve diagnosing the cause of the faucet problem, removing damaged components, and installing new parts to ensure the fixture functions efficiently. Homeowners typically seek these services when experiencing persistent drips, difficulty turning the faucet on or off, or reduced water pressure, aiming to restore convenience and prevent further water waste.

Property owners should understand the specifics of their faucet type and any existing plumbing configurations before requesting repair services. Clarifying the nature of the issue, the age of the fixture, and any previous repairs can help in assessing the scope of work needed. It’s also helpful to know if the faucet is part of a larger renovation or if there are specific style or finish preferences. This information supports a smooth repair process and ensures the fixture operates reliably afterward.

Common Bathroom Faucet Repair Jobs

Leaking Faucet Repairs - fix dripping or constant leaks to prevent water waste and damage.

Handle and Cartridge Replacement - restore smooth operation by replacing worn or broken handles and cartridges.

Valve Repairs - address issues with water flow control to ensure proper faucet function.

Fixture Upgrades - update outdated or damaged faucets for improved appearance and performance.

Leak Detection and Repair - identify hidden leaks behind walls or under sinks and resolve them promptly.

Corrosion and Mineral Build-up Removal - clean and restore faucet components affected by hard water deposits.

Bathroom Faucet Repair Questions

What are common signs that a bathroom faucet needs repair? Leaking, dripping sounds, low water pressure, or difficulty turning the handle are typical indicators of faucet issues.

Can a faulty faucet cause water damage? Yes, leaks or drips can lead to water pooling and potential damage to cabinetry or flooring over time.

What types of faucet repairs are usually needed? Repairs often involve replacing washers, cartridges, or seals, and fixing leaks or handle issues.

Is it necessary to replace an entire faucet for minor problems? Not always; many issues can be fixed with targeted repairs without replacing the entire fixture.
